|  |  Inclusion and Exclusion – A Governor’s Role, Summer term (Cancelled) |  |
|  | Starts: | Monday 13 June 2022 12.00 - 14.00 | Code: GOV6 |  |  |  | Venue: | Online, MS Teams, ## | Map | |  |  |  | About this course | This course aims to give governors a clear understanding of the importance of including all pupils in their school. It will cover governor’s statutory duties to oversee the exclusion process, including their legal responsibilities, how to run a panel, and how to hear appeals.
Governors will also learn which children are vulnerable to exclusion and the impact that excluding children has on them.

|  | 'Bitesize' EYFS information session - Meaningful maths |  |
|  | Starts: | Monday 13 June 2022 18.00-19.00 | Code: EYFS16 |  |  |  | Venue: | Online, MS Teams, ## | Map | |  |  |  | About this course | Aimed at age range 3 to 4 year olds. EYFS practitioners in the private, voluntary and independent sectors, childminders and school based nurseries.
The purpose of these ‘bite-sized’ sessions is to provide practitioners with a short training session on a current topic of interest. We hope to spark some ideas and inspire you to find out more!
‘Developing a strong grounding in number is essential so that all children develop the necessary building blocks to excel mathematically’ - EYFS Statutory Framework, Mathematics.
How do we develop a deep understanding of numbers whilst also developing a positive, ‘have a go’ attitude to maths?
This ‘bite-sized’ training will give a very brief overview of how the emphasis on numbers in maths has changed in the new EYFS. It will provide links to websites and articles so you can take it back to your staff and find out more.
